人机交互(HCI)是计算机科学和人工智能领域的一个重要分支,它研究如何使计算机系统能够与人类用户进行有效的交流和互动。随着技术的不断发展,人机交互的方式也在不断创新,以满足不同用户的需求。以下是六种常见的人机交互方式:
1. 自然语言:自然语言是一种基于词汇、语法和语义的人类语言形式。在人机交互中,自然语言处理技术允许计算机理解和生成自然语言文本。这种交互方式使得用户可以通过口头或书面的形式与计算机进行交流,而计算机则能理解并回应这些自然语言表达的内容。自然语言交互方式的优点在于其普遍性和灵活性,因为几乎所有使用过计算机的人都熟悉自然语言。然而,自然语言交互也面临着一些挑战,如歧义性、情感表达和语境理解等。为了解决这些问题,研究人员正在开发更先进的自然语言处理技术和算法,以提高自然语言交互的准确性和自然度。
2. 触摸:触摸是一种直接与计算机硬件进行交互的方式。通过触摸屏幕、键盘、鼠标或其他输入设备,用户可以向计算机发送命令或反馈信息。触摸交互方式的优点在于其直观性和易用性,用户无需学习复杂的指令集即可与计算机进行交互。然而,触摸交互也面临着一些挑战,如手指遮挡、误触和手势识别等。为了提高触摸交互的准确性和自然度,研究人员正在开发更先进的触摸传感器和识别技术,以实现更精确的触摸控制和更自然的手势识别。
3. 手势识别:手势识别是一种通过分析用户的手势来与计算机进行交互的方式。这种交互方式通常用于移动应用和游戏,其中用户可以用手指在空中绘制或拖动对象。手势识别技术可以捕捉到用户的手势动作,并将其转换为计算机可以理解的命令或操作。手势识别交互方式的优点在于其灵活性和直观性,用户无需记住复杂的命令集即可与计算机进行交互。然而,手势识别也面临着一些挑战,如手势多样性、误识别和环境干扰等。为了提高手势识别的准确性和自然度,研究人员正在开发更先进的手势识别算法和传感器,以实现更精确的手势识别和更自然的手势控制。
4. 语音控制:语音控制是一种通过语音信号与计算机进行交互的方式。这种交互方式通常用于智能助手、语音导航和语音输入法等应用。语音控制技术可以将用户的语音输入转换为计算机可以理解的命令或操作。语音控制交互方式的优点在于其便捷性和通用性,用户无需手动输入命令即可与计算机进行交互。然而,语音控制也面临着一些挑战,如语音识别准确性、噪音干扰和多任务处理等。为了提高语音控制的准确性和自然度,研究人员正在开发更先进的语音识别技术和算法,以实现更精确的语音识别和更自然的语音控制。
5. 眼动追踪:眼动追踪是一种通过分析用户的眼球运动来与计算机进行交互的方式。这种交互方式通常用于虚拟现实、增强现实和游戏等领域。眼动追踪技术可以捕捉到用户的眼球运动轨迹,并将其转换为计算机可以理解的动作或操作。眼动追踪交互方式的优点在于其沉浸感和实时性,用户可以通过眼球运动来与计算机进行交互,仿佛置身于虚拟环境中。然而,眼动追踪也面临着一些挑战,如眼动追踪准确性、数据隐私和眼动控制等。为了提高眼动追踪的准确性和自然度,研究人员正在开发更先进的眼动追踪技术和算法,以实现更精确的眼动追踪和更自然的眼动控制。
6. 脑电波解读:脑电波解读是一种通过分析用户的脑电信号来与计算机进行交互的方式。这种交互方式通常用于神经科学、心理学和康复治疗等领域。脑电波解读技术可以捕捉到用户的脑电信号变化,并将其转换为计算机可以理解的信号或操作。脑电波解读交互方式的优点在于其非侵入性和无创性,用户无需佩戴任何设备即可与计算机进行交互。然而,脑电波解读也面临着一些挑战,如脑电信号噪声、脑电信号解析和脑电信号控制等。为了提高脑电波解读的准确性和自然度,研究人员正在开发更先进的脑电波解读技术和算法,以实现更精确的脑电波解读和更自然的脑电波控制。
总之,人机交互的方式多种多样,每种方式都有其独特的优点和挑战。随着技术的不断发展,我们期待未来的人机交互将更加自然、高效和安全。